Output 3bcd86e35c56619c884eed906cce37139d20ee7e750ee42a313497605df77f87:0

value
11859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1e6c139de01c1510f79ec09c7316cc6468a1758 OP_EQUAL
address
3Hufxd1E81XY8aPa18RwYH8j8BEHDJJbeb
transaction
3bcd86e35c56619c884eed906cce37139d20ee7e750ee42a313497605df77f87
spent
true